OK, considering they are miles clear of La Liga, and they possess the trident, the holy trinity of Messi, Suarez and Neymar, im fully prepared to be shot down here. But Barca on fm16 isnt as easy as other big clubs like Real, Bayern and PSG.

 

It poses some unique challenges:

 

1) The makers of the game seem to have over-estimated the quality of Real Madrid on the game, and they are a potent force that are very difficult to overcome.

 

2) Competing on 6 different fronts this season means there are a seriously high number of games to get through, and the board demand success in all competitions naturally. But in keeping with point 3....

 

3) You start the game under embargo, and you have a tiny squad that you somehow need to keep fresh through a number of matches, yet you dont have the players that you can rotate with. The squad players are significantly weaker than the first choice players.

 

4) WIth the embargo being on the club, you cant strengthen the squad in the summer. And Arda Turan and Aleix Vidal cant kick a ball for you until January. There are also players like Matthieu who need to be improved on, no decent striker backup, and a few aeging players that need to be replaced soon.

 

5) The transfer budget is significantly smaller than that of Real Madrid.

 

6) Its not easy to replicate the style Barca have in real life on the game. Fitting the front 3 into a good system and getting them to interchange and rotate the way they would under Luis Enrique, its difficult to capture this in the game. The fluidity of the formation is difficult to achieve too, and doesnt really happen justby selecting the "very fluid" option.

 

 

Obviously you stand a great chance of winning lots of trophies, but there is still a challenge with Barca.

To be fair, the interplay between Neymar, Messi and Suarez is so ridiculously good at times that I'm not sure anyone would know where to begin scripting it in gaming terms.

The tactical side can be quite restrictive, though. I'd personally like to see a massive overhaul whereby you completely build offensive and defensive systems separately.

It's nigh impossible to fully recreate Leicester in the game, for example, because it somehow baffles FM that an attacking player with attacking duties might also do a hell of a lot of closing down and tackling.

I want to be able to have everyone pressing and closing down ridiculously and then springing to attack ridiculously.

That may very well result in my whole team being absolutely knackered by the twentieth minute but that's my choice to make.
